The Mayor of the City of Schenectady is authorized,
with the approval of the Corporation Counsel, to execute proofs of
loss and releases of claims in favor of the City if the payment to
the City is for the amount of the claim or if the claim by the City
does not exceed $500. A release of a claim in excess of $500 is subject
to approval by the City Council if the amount to be paid to the City
is less than the amount of the claim.

A. The Corporation Counsel is authorized to enter into
writing agreements settling claims against the City for amounts not
exceeding $500 each. If the Claims Committee of the City Council approves
a settlement, the Director of Finance is authorized to pay the agreed
amount and to charge the appropriate budget code. The Corporation
Counsel shall file with the City Council a monthly written report
of claims so settled.
B. The Corporation Counsel, with the informal approval
of the Claims Committee, is authorized to enter into written agreements
settling claims against the City for amounts in excess of $500 each.
If the City Council by resolution approves a settlement, the Director
of Finance is authorized to pay the agreed amount and to charge the
appropriate budget code.
